  • 1.  Cannot upgrade firmware from custom location

    Posted Apr 07, 2025 07:33 AM

    Dear Experts, 

    I am trying to upgrade the firmware of 6100 switch from a local webserver (HFS – HTTP File Server). I can see that switch attempts to access the file but then i get this error (Upgrade: failed: Failed to execute Firmware Upgrade CLI.).

    Any idea what might be the issue, i tried with both http and https(self signed cert), same error.

  • 4.  RE: Cannot upgrade firmware from custom location

    Posted Apr 07, 2025 07:52 PM

    custom build are used for especial firmware that are made available in Aruba Central. generally they are made available by TAC.
